Composer:New English HymnalGenre:ChoralStyle:ChoralAverage_duration:3:57"Faith of our fathers" is a hymn that was composed by Frederick William Faber in 1849. It was first published in his collection "Jesus and Mary: or Catholic Hymns for Singing and Reading." The hymn was later included in the New English Hymnal, which was published in 1986.
